Market Overview

Crawler dozers are heavy tracked machines designed for pushing large quantities of soil, sand, rubble, or other materials. Unlike wheeled dozers, crawler dozers are equipped with continuous tracks that provide enhanced traction and stability, allowing them to operate efficiently on uneven, muddy, or rough terrains. Their robustness and versatility make them indispensable in construction, agriculture, forestry, and mining projects worldwide.

The global Crawler Dozers Market was valued at USD 9.41 billion in 2024 and is expected to expand from USD 10.06 billion in 2025 to USD 19.65 billion by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.92% during the forecast period (2025–2035).

The global crawler dozers market has experienced healthy growth in recent years, propelled by an increase in public infrastructure investments and large-scale construction projects. Governments and private sectors in emerging economies are allocating significant budgets toward the development of highways, ports, rail networks, and energy facilities, which in turn boosts the demand for high-performance dozers.

Key Market Drivers

  • Infrastructure and Construction Boom

Infrastructure development remains the most influential growth driver for the crawler dozers market. Rapid urbanization and the need for improved transportation systems have led to an increased demand for heavy machinery capable of handling challenging terrains and large-scale earthmoving operations. Countries in Asia-Pacific, the Middle East, and Africa are at the forefront of this trend, with ongoing projects in roads, smart cities, and housing developments fueling the use of crawler dozers.

  • Growth in the Mining Sector

Mining is another major contributor to crawler dozer demand. These machines are essential for clearing land, creating access roads, and assisting in the extraction and transportation of minerals. The expansion of mining operations in regions rich in natural resources—such as Australia, Latin America, and parts of Africa—has created a consistent need for efficient dozers that can endure high-intensity workloads.

  • Technological Advancements

Modern crawler dozers are becoming increasingly advanced with the integration of GPS, telematics, and autonomous operation systems. Smart technologies enable precise grading, fuel optimization, and real-time monitoring, reducing operational costs and increasing productivity. Manufacturers are focusing on designing eco-friendly dozers with low-emission engines to comply with global environmental standards, thus catering to the growing preference for sustainable machinery.

  • Rising Demand in Agriculture and Forestry

Crawler dozers are also finding increasing applications in agriculture and forestry. Farmers and plantation owners use them for land leveling, clearing vegetation, and preparing large tracts of land for cultivation. Similarly, forestry operations depend on crawler dozers for managing timber harvests and maintaining access roads, further diversifying the equipment’s end-user base.

Market Challenges

Despite the promising outlook, the crawler dozers market faces several challenges. The high initial investment and maintenance costs can deter small and medium-scale contractors from purchasing new units. In addition, fluctuations in raw material prices and the availability of low-cost substitutes such as excavators or wheeled loaders can hinder market growth. Furthermore, the shortage of skilled operators and the slow pace of technological adoption in developing regions remain obstacles to seamless market expansion.

Regional Insights

The Asia-Pacific region currently leads the global crawler dozers market, supported by the booming construction and mining industries in China, India, and Southeast Asia. Massive investments in transportation networks and industrial infrastructure are generating robust demand for efficient earthmoving equipment.

North America follows closely, where the United States and Canada benefit from advanced construction technologies, strong replacement demand, and steady investments in residential and commercial building projects. The integration of smart machine control systems and sustainability-driven equipment upgrades also fuel market growth.

Europe is witnessing a gradual rise in demand for energy-efficient and compact crawler dozers, particularly in countries such as Germany, France, and the UK, where regulatory compliance and environmental standards are stringent.

Meanwhile,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are emerging as promising regions due to growing mining activities and infrastructure modernization initiatives. Increased foreign investments and government-backed infrastructure programs are expected to open new growth opportunities for dozer manufacturers in these regions.

Competitive Landscape

The crawler dozers market is moderately consolidated, with several key players competing through innovation, product differentiation, and service excellence. Leading manufacturers focus on enhancing machine durability, fuel efficiency, and automation capabilities. The use of hybrid and electric propulsion technologies is gaining momentum as companies aim to reduce carbon emissions and operating costs.

Prominent players in the market are also expanding their after-sales support and rental services to attract a broader customer base. Equipment leasing and financing options have become vital strategies to address cost-related barriers and encourage adoption among small contractors.

Major Players

Caterpillar (US), Komatsu (JP), John Deere (US), Case Construction (US), Doosan Infracore (KR), Hitachi Construction Machinery (JP), Liebherr (DE), SANY (CN), JCB (GB)
